15 Classic Souvenirs from New York City

January 18, 2022 | More: New York City| Souvenirs

If you have never been to New York City, then you’re missing out on one of the greatest cities in the world. This city of five boroughs is where the Hudson River meets the Atlantic Ocean. Manhattan is the densest borough and one of the world’s major cultural, financial, and commercial centers. In this borough, you’ll see iconic landmarks like the Empire State Building and the sprawling Central Park. The neon-lit Times Square is where Broadway plays are staged.

If you’re looking for souvenirs from your trip to New York, don’t miss the Empire State Building. The Observatory Store on the 86th floor sells a wide variety of items to remember your visit to the tallest building in the world. From the famous “I NY” t-shirt to beautiful panoramic posters of the city skyline, you can find something to suit any style or budget. Toys and books for all ages are available at the store, as are ice-cream mugs, cookies, and chocolates.
